    Project Spifire or hunt for a Magnum 27 or maybe.?

    So having sold my 22 back in November I'm starting to miss it. I'd like something a bit more substantial...kind of to keep the wife more or less happy but still in the spirit and style of the 22.

    Back in 2011 I found a Spitfire and the guy still has it and is now willing to let it go. ...will see it in the next few days but it may be quite an undertaking so good possibility not worth it. For sure needs engines/drives but it has been sitting for years and I suspect it is pretty rough.

    I like the idea of a unique Donzi Spitfire and of course I'd really like a Magnum 27...just can't find them very easily (maybe I should have bought that hull that just sold here). Thinking of maybe a Pantera 24 or maybe 28.

    I suspect I'd have more than the Spit is worth in just engines/drives and probably have 40-50K in it pretty quickly.

    Anyone care to weigh in? ...anyone know where there is a good 24-28 boat available that fits my parameters? ...has to have that old school style.

    I guess it also depends on you're location. I love the 27 Magnum. Which I have a 25 IMP Eleganza which is a essentially the same hull as the 27 Mag Minus 2ft. The Pantera 28 or the 24 would get my vote for next. I prefer a single Engine Pantera but that's just me. A friend of mine has a nice 28 Pantera with twin 96's if you're looking? I'm in Maryland so all our boating is done on the Chesapeake.
